Energy analysts are exploring a potential upside scenario for Venezuelan crude production. According to recent assessments, the country could ramp up output by as much as 700,000 barrels per day in the medium term, assuming operational improvements and investment stabilization in the sector.
Why does this matter? Oil production directly influences global energy prices and inflation dynamics—factors that ripple through financial markets and investor sentiment. A meaningful increase in Venezuelan supply could ease pressure on crude prices if geopolitical conditions permit.
For crypto traders tracking macro trends, this type of supply-side shift in commodities feeds into broader inflation narratives and central bank policy expectations. Energy cost pressures remain one of the key variables shaping economic outlook and market volatility.
The timing and execution of such production gains remain uncertain, but the possibility reinforces how geopolitical and resource-driven developments continue to shape global economic conditions that indirectly impact digital asset valuations.
